Differences in Tuberculosis Prevalence by Sex Over 1993-2024: A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is
Background: Tuberculosis (TB) prevalence is higher among men than women in low- and middle-income countries (LMICs). However, summary measures of sex difference
1/ Itโs been 10 years (๐ฎ) since we reported that #TB prevalence was twice as high in men as in women.
๐ข Our new preprint explores how sex differences have shifted with more recent national prevalence surveys and growing attention to #gender responsive TB prevention and care.

Figure 1. Estimated number of trial endpoints in the control group of a prevention-of-disease vaccine trial in a high disease-burden setting showing number of endpoints on the y-axis and time in months on the x-axis. For bacteriologically confirmed symptomatic tuberculosis disease endpoints only, we estimate 69 endpoints, and for combined bacteriologically confirmed asymptomatic and symptomatic tuberculosis disease endpoints, we estimate 151 endpoints. Scenario assumes symptomatic disease incidence before trial screening of 300/100โ000 per year and following 10โ000 individuals over 3 years. Prevalent symptomatic and asymptomatic tuberculosis disease are screened out in month 0 and are not trial endpoints. Active screening occurs every 6 months for both scenarios and participants self-presenting with symptoms suggestive of tuberculosis disease would also be investigated.
In our latest personal view in @lancetrespirmed.bsky.social, we argue for the inclusion asymptomatic #tuberculosis in vaccine trial endpoints to potentially reduce the size, length, and cost of trials.
